You can use Group Policy or an MDM solution like Intune to configure Delivery Optimization. They include maximum download bandwidths (in percent or, since Windows 10 2004, also absolute values) in the foreground and background, using monthly upper limits in GB, and defining business hours during which the transfer volume can be limited. Several settings help to avoid network congestion caused by DO Group policy also provides numerous settings, regardless of connection type, to control the load on the network from peer-to-peer communication. If you want to change this default behavior, you can do so via the setting Enable peer caching while the device is connected over a VPN. In this case, the DO deactivates all peer-to-peer activities.
